Apply now »

Software Developer

Functional area:  Research & Development
Onsite or Remote:  Onsite
Country/Region:  ZA
City:  Centurion
Location: 

Centurion, GT, ZA, 157

Company name:  Epiroc Digital Safety Solutions South Af
Date of posting:  Mar 19, 2026

Are you ready?

 

Mission of the role:

Join us as a Software Developer.  You will support the design, development, and maintenance of software applications under the guidance of senior developers. Contribute to building scalable, reliable, and secure solutions while following best practices and development processes.

 

Your Mission:

  • Develop and maintain front-end and back-end components of software applications.
  • Write clean, efficient, and well-documented code.
  • Collaborate with senior developers and cross-functional teams to implement features and fix bugs.
  • Participate in code reviews, testing, and troubleshooting to ensure software quality.
  • Assist in creating and maintaining API documentation.
  • Follow version control, change management, and software development lifecycle processes.
  • Continuously improve skills and contribute to team knowledge sharing.

 

Your Profile:

  • Bachelor’s degree in Computer Science, Software Engineering, or related field.
  • 2-5 years of software development experience, preferably in full stack or similar roles.
  • Hands-on experience in coding, testing, and debugging software applications.
  • Knowledge of SQL database design and optimization is a plus.
  • Experience with software documentation and maintaining code quality.

 

 

Location: Centurion, Pretoria

Closing Date: 02 April 2026

 

Why Epiroc?

By joining our team, you’ll make a big difference in the energy transition. At Epiroc, we take pride in being passionate innovators, driving the change toward a brighter future for both people and the planet. Guided by our values of Collaboration, Commitment, and Innovation, we foster a culture of trust, growth, and lasting impact.    

 

It all starts with people. The world needs metals and minerals for the energy transition and our cities and infrastructure must be developed to serve a growing population. To succeed, we need to speed up the shift towards more sustainable mining and construction industries. We at Epiroc accelerate this transformation, together with customers and business partners in more than 150 countries, by developing and providing innovative and safe equipment, digital solutions, and aftermarket support.

 

All new thinkers are welcome. We are looking for those who want to develop, grow, and dare to think new. In Epiroc we attract, develop, and retain diverse talent valuing authenticity and unique perspectives, driving our spirit of innovation. We foster an inclusive culture where diversity isn't just a goal but a part of our values and way of working. This is how we do business for a sustainable future. Learn more at www.epiroc.com


Job Segment: R&D Engineer, Test Engineer, Testing, Sustainability, Developer, Engineering, Technology, Energy

Apply now »